The Thanksgiving table presents a unique design challenge: it must hold an entire holiday feast while still looking festive and welcoming. To succeed, you need to balance function with flair. Start with a neutral, washable tablecloth as your canvas, then layer in texture with a burlap runner or linen napkins.
For the centerpiece, keep it low, a collection of small pumpkins, gourds, and taper candles in varied heights avoids blocking conversation. Finally, use simple place cards and seasonal foliage to tie it together, ensuring your setup remains practical for passing dishes.
Key takeaways
- Choose warm, earthy tones like burnt orange, deep red, and gold, which complement autumn produce and create a cohesive table.
- Build a low, wide centerpiece using a hollowed pumpkin or a wooden tray filled with seasonal gourds, pinecones, and short-stemmed flowers so guests can see across the table.
- Layer your place settings with a natural linen runner, ceramic dinner plates, and cloth napkins in contrasting fall hues, then add a single sprig of rosemary or a mini pumpkin at each seat.
- Use multiple candle heights, tall taper candles flanking a short pillar candle, to cast warm, flickering light, and place them in glass hurricanes to prevent drafts.
- Set the table the night before and keep a spray bottle of water nearby to mist fresh greenery and flowers periodically, ensuring they stay lively through the meal.

Buying guide
Measure the table before choosing the decoration
Tablecloths, runners, and placemats fail most often because the proportions are wrong. Measure the actual tabletop after extension leaves are installed, then decide how much drop or overhang you want. A 72-inch runner can work well on a compact four-to-six-person table but may look abruptly short on an extended holiday table, while a 120-inch gauze runner can be gathered when extra length is available.
Protect serving space before adding a centerpiece
Thanksgiving tables need more usable surface than ordinary dinner tables because serving bowls, gravy, bread, drinks, and hot dishes often arrive at once. Keep tall or bulky decor out of the center unless food will be served buffet-style. Low pumpkins, narrow runners, placemats, place-card holders, and slim candle holders generally interfere less with passing dishes.
Choose materials based on cleanup, not photographs
Polyester and cotton-blend linens are usually the practical choices for a working dinner table because they can be laundered after spills. Natural water-hyacinth mats should be wiped rather than soaked, velvet pumpkins are decorative rather than washable, and cheesecloth runners are intentionally delicate. If children, red wine, or gravy are likely to be involved, put washable textiles closest to the food.
Control centerpiece height
Guests should be able to see one another without leaning around the centerpiece. Small pumpkins and low greenery can stay directly in the conversation zone, while taller hurricane candle holders are better spaced between place settings or moved toward the ends of the table. If an arrangement blocks eye contact when you sit down, it’s too tall for the center.
Use one strong seasonal signal, then simplify
A pumpkin-and-leaf runner already announces fall, so it doesn’t need matching pumpkin napkins, pumpkin placemats, pumpkin plates, and pumpkin candles. Conversely, a neutral tablecloth and woven placemats can handle several small seasonal accents without feeling busy. The easiest formula is one obvious Thanksgiving element supported by quieter textures and solid colors.
Common mistakes
- Setting the table before inserting extension leaves. A runner or tablecloth that looked correctly proportioned on the everyday table can suddenly be far too short once the holiday seating plan is expanded.
- Building the centerpiece before placing the serving dishes. Hosts often discover too late that the attractive middle arrangement occupies the exact space needed for stuffing, vegetables, gravy, and bread.
- Opening natural woven placemats immediately before guests arrive. Water-hyacinth products can have an unpacking odor or arrive slightly warped, so giving them time to air out and flatten avoids a last-minute problem.
- Assuming small decorative items will look substantial because product photos are tightly cropped. Mini place-card pumpkins and three-inch faux pumpkins work best as repeated accents or grouped arrangements, not as the only centerpiece on a long table.

Should a Thanksgiving centerpiece be tall or low?
Low is usually better for a seated dinner. Guests should be able to maintain eye contact across the table, so reserve taller candle holders or arrangements for the ends of the table or areas that don’t interrupt conversation.
Are placemats useful if I already have a tablecloth?
Yes, if they add needed texture or visually define each place setting. They’re less useful when the table is already crowded, because a large round mat plus charger plus dinner plate can consume significant width.
Is a cheesecloth runner practical for Thanksgiving dinner?
It’s practical as decoration, not as table protection. Gauze runners are good for soft draping and layering around candles or pumpkins, but spills can pass through them and the loose weave requires gentler handling than standard polyester linens.
How much Thanksgiving-themed decor should go on the table?
Usually less than you think. Use one clear seasonal element such as a harvest-pattern tablecloth, printed runner, or small pumpkins, then let neutral napkins, woven textures, candles, and ordinary dinnerware support it rather than repeating the same motif everywhere.
